1. 什么是MySQL數據庫?
MySQL是一種關系型數據庫管理系統,由瑞典MySQL AB公司開發并維護。它是一款開源軟件,廣泛應用于各種網站、應用程序和企業級系統中。
2. MySQL的優點有哪些?
MySQL具有以下優點:開源免費、高性能、可擴展性強、支持多種操作系統、易于使用和管理、廣泛應用等。
3. MySQL的數據類型有哪些?
yintallintediuminttteeestamp等。
4. 如何創建MySQL數據庫?
可以使用CREATE DATABASE語句創建MySQL數據庫,語法如下:
ame為要創建的數據庫名稱。
5. 如何創建MySQL數據表?
可以使用CREATE TABLE語句創建MySQL數據表,語法如下:
ame (n1 datatype,n2 datatype,n3 datatype,
......
amen為數據表的列名,datatype為列的數據類型。
6. 什么是MySQL索引?
MySQL索引是一種用于加速查詢的數據結構,可以幫助數據庫快速定位到符合條件的數據。MySQL支持多種索引類型,包括B樹索引、哈希索引、全文索引等。
7. 如何創建MySQL索引?
可以使用CREATE INDEX語句創建MySQL索引,語法如下:
dexameamen1n2, ...);
dexameamen為要創建索引的列名。
8. 什么是MySQL事務?
MySQL事務是一組數據庫操作,要么全部執行,要么全部回滾。MySQL支持ACID事務特性,即原子性、一致性、隔離性和持久性。
9. 如何使用MySQL事務?
可以使用START TRANSACTION語句開始一個MySQL事務,使用COMMIT語句提交事務,使用ROLLBACK語句回滾事務。例如:
START TRANSACTION;tcece - 100 WHERE id = 1;tcece + 100 WHERE id = 2;
COMMIT;
10. 如何優化MySQL查詢?
可以通過優化查詢語句、使用索引、調整MySQL參數等方式來優化MySQL查詢性能。例如,可以使用EXPLAIN語句分析查詢語句的執行計劃,找出慢查詢的原因并進行優化。